(C語言)簡單的絕對值排序

2021-10-03 18:43:05 字數 738 閱讀 1649

6-17 絕對值排序 (10分)

輸入n個整數,按照絕對值從大到小排序後輸出。題目保證對於每乙個測試例項,所有的數的絕對值都不相等。

輸入格式:

每行輸入乙個n,然後下一行輸入n個整形數字,(所有資料範圍<=100)

輸出格式:

輸出n個絕對值從大到小排序的整型數字,每兩個數字之間有乙個空格。

函式介面定義:

在這裡描述函式介面。例如:

void cn(int a,int n);

裁判測試程式樣例:

在這裡給出函式被呼叫進行測試的例子。例如:

#include

#include

void cn(int a,int n);

int main()

return 0;

}/* 請在這裡填寫答案 */

輸入樣例:

在這裡給出一組輸入。例如:

51 8 4 3 2

輸出樣例:

在這裡給出相應的輸出。例如:

8 4 3 2 1

#include

#include

void cn(int a,int n)}}

for(i=0;iprintf("%d 「,a[i]);

printf(」%d",a[n-1]);//格式要求,兩個數之間要有乙個空格//

return ;//結束運算//

}int main()

return 0;

}

絕對值排序 C語言

description 輸入n n 100 個整數,按照絕對值從大到小排序後輸出。題目保證對於每乙個測試例項,所有的數的絕對值都不相等。input 輸入資料有多組,每組佔一行,每行的第乙個數字為n,接著是n個整數,n 0表示輸入資料的結束,不做處理。output 對於每個測試例項,輸出排序後的結果,...

絕對值排序(C語言)

problem description 輸入n n 100 個整數,按照絕對值從大到小排序後輸出。題目保證對於每乙個測試例項,所有的數的絕對值都不相等。input 輸入資料有多組,每組佔一行,每行的第乙個數字為n,接著是n個整數,n 0表示輸入資料的結束,不做處理。output 對於每個測試例項,輸...

c 絕對值排序

problem description 輸入n n 100 個整數,按照絕對值從大到小排序後輸出。題目保證對於每乙個測試例項,所有的數的絕對值都不相等。input 輸入資料有多組,每組佔一行,每行的第乙個數字為n,接著是n個整數,n 0表示輸入資料的結束,不做處理。output 對於每個測試例項,輸...